So, 'Tour du monde' dives into this unique soccer tournament, the Coupe Nationale Des Quartiers in Créteil. It’s fascinating how it showcases teams from various nations, all battling for that Champions Trophy. The film captures this vibrant atmosphere, and you really get a sense of community and cultural exchange. The pacing feels just right, not rushed, allowing you to soak in the stories behind each team. The practical effects and real-life interactions bring a raw authenticity that you don’t often find in typical sports documentaries. The way it highlights the personal experiences of the players adds depth to the competition. There’s something distinct about seeing soccer through this lens—definitely a slice of life you don't see every day.
